Grade Level: 3-5, 6-8, 9-12

Students will identify and describe the relationship between land cover classification and surface temperature as they relate to the urban heat island effect. Students will also describe patterns between population density and the locations of urban heat islands. 



Grade Level: 6-8, 9-12

In this interactive, students will explore safe methods for viewing the Sun at home or in the classroom, including using solar eclipse glasses and a pinhole projector. The interactive includes a video that explains how the projector works and how to build one.


Grade Level: 3-5, 6-8, 9-12

This story map allows students to explore the urban heat island effect using land surface temperature and vegetation data in a 5 E-learning cycle. Students investigate the processes that create differences in surface temperatures, as well as how human activities have led to the creation of urban heat islands.

Grade Level: 9-12

Students interpret AQI maps and charts to compare todayā€™s AQI with the past five days. Using the EPAā€™s air quality activity guides, students create a social media post for residents of their region providing key information related to todayā€™s AQI.
